Brrrrr. Bangor Hydro Electric Company is reporting that there is a power outage this morning in the Bradley and Milford area, affecting 1300 customers. Line crews are on the scene, and they are working in the 15 below temperature to quickly and safely restore the power. Here's the latest information from Bangor Hydro Electric Company.

Restoration Details:Bangor Hydro crews are on the scene working to restore service to more than 1,300 customers in Milford and Bradley this morning. The cause is under investigation but line workers have arrived in the area and are working to identify and correct the issue as safely and quickly as possible.

Customers are reminded to never touch a downed line or a tree in contact with one, fully charge cell phones so they’re ready in case of emergency, and those using alternate heating sources should be sure to follow manufacturer safety precautions.
